[f. LAW sb.1 + GIVING ppl. a.] That gives or makes laws. Also occas. that gives the law to or determines.
1581. Sidney, Apol. Poetrie (Arb.), 22. In Turky, besides their lawe-giuing Diuines, they haue no other Writers but Poets.
1645. Milton, Tetrach., Wks. 1851, IV. 196. As if the will of God were becom sinfull, or sin stronger then his direct and Law-giving will.
1827. Hare, Guesses (1859), 310. Men would still worship the creature, under the form of abstractions and laws, instead of the living, lawgiving Creator.
1865. Grote, Plato, I. i. 11. The nature of number was imperative and lawgiving.
